IPCC Agriculture — Emissions Share in Spain
Spain: IPCC Agriculture — Emissions Share was 60.14 % in 2023. ▬ Flat
IPCC Agriculture — Emissions Share in Spain, 1990–2023
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. Measured in %.
Analysis
In 2023, ipcc agriculture — emissions share in Spain stood at 60.14 %.
That represents a change of down 0.8% on the previous year and up 3.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, ipcc agriculture — emissions share in Spain peaked at 62.16 % in 1990 and was at its lowest, 55.58 %, in 2009.
That places Spain 68th out of 209 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ions indicators disseminates indicators on sectoral shares of total national gre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ions as well as three indicators of emissions intensity: per capita emissions; emissions per value of agricultural production; and emissions per area of agricultural land.
